Humble, TX Outdoor Self-Storage

Showing 13 - 13 of 13 Outdoor Storage Facilities Indoor Storage
Public Storage - Houston - 8633 W Airport Blvd

Public Storage - Houston - 8633 W Airport Blvd

Houston, TX 77071
29.4 miles away
Promotion: $1 first month rent Call Now
Starting At: $125.00 per month
Showing 13 - 13 of 13 Storage Facilities